I recently resumed the first Legend of Heroes game that was released on the PSP in English. I started it a few years ago. It's okay, but even for a remade retro RPG, it is pretty basic. Black magic attacks may or may not be effective towards enemies, so I usually don't even bother with them and just use melee attacks. White magic such as healing consumes very little MP, and the pet cat is constantly finding items for me. It is very charming, but simplistic, linear, and easy. It's main charm is the fact that it's a remade version of an old early '90s RPG. That and the confusing grammatical errors in the translation.

I got off work early today and headed to a Sega game center in town I haven't been to before. I was pleased to find Death Smiles right next to Dungeons & Dragons: Shadow Over Mystaria. 100 yen gave two credits. I 1CCd (1 credit cleared) the game with Sakyura (I think that's her name... the witch who looks like Maria from Sakura Taisen) and scored 28,668,489. With the second game, I played Casper and 1CCd it again, but with only 18,182,861 points. I think I played this game after it first came out in Japan, and the last time I played it was a few years ago on my bud's 360 (I don't own any current gen game systems). On top of that, while playing the game the second time through, the left direction shooting button stopped responding half the time. Often I had to smack it 3 times before it started shooting left. I chose at random the levels 1-3, but I did not choose the level 999 (I bet that's more akin to a typical Cave game).
